85 Proper instrument panel vent removal instructions 85 20 23 2061673/1 December 16, 2020. Model(s) Year VIN Range Vehicle-Specific Equipment A3, S3 2017 – 2020 All Not Applicable A3 Cabriolet 2017 - 2019 All Not Applicable A3 e-tron 2017 - 2018 All Not Applicable Condition The instrument panel vents can easily be damaged if removed incorrectly. Technical Background If the instrument panel vent is removed by prying from the adjustment ring the outlet mechanics are permanently damaged. The ring is dislodged from the detents and adjustment is no longer possible (Figure 1). Figure 1. Incorrect removal method for the instrument panel vent. Production Solution Not applicable. Service 1. Correct removal of the instrument panel vents is specified in ElsaPro and requires the use of (2) T40207 hook tools, (2) 3438 T-Handle Hooks or (2) fabricated hook tools (Figure 2). Insert each hook carefully through the slats in the diffuser, engage the center crossbrace and pull outward (Figure 4). Figure 4. Correct removal of the instrument panel vents.
